The history of the Toronto Islands is filled with characters larger than life and touched by great historic events. More than one million visitors a year take a ferry ride to the Islands, but very few know the remarkable stories that have unfolded there over the past two hundred years.

Join a guided tour, using modern-day video and rare archival images, from the early days of the lighthouse keepers to the War of 1812 - storms and shipwrecks, lives lost and saved. Along the way, meet Canada's first World Champion (Ned Hanlan) and a hero (William Ward) who saved more than 160 souls from watery graves.
